Physical properties

Hardness: 6.5-7 on Mohs scale; Color: Reddish-orange, brownish-red; Luster: Vitreous to waxy; Crystal Structure: Trigonal/Hexagonal (microcrystalline); Specific Gravity: 2.58-2.64

Formation & geological history

Formed in volcanic cavities and sedimentary rocks at low temperatures when silica-rich fluids deposit microcrystalline quartz. Found in modern deposits and ancient volcanic basalt flows globally.

Uses & applications

Primarily used in jewelry, lapidary arts for cabochon cutting, and as a meditative or collector stone.

Geological facts

Carnelian has been used for over 4,500 years; ancient Egyptians called it 'the setting sun' and used it in amulets. Napoleon Bonaparte famously wore a carnelian seal found during his Egyptian campaign.

Field identification & locations

Identify by its translucent waxy luster and brownish-red hue. It is commonly found in India, Brazil, Uruguay, and Madagascar. Collectors look for uniform color and high translucency.
